Job description

The Senior Low Voltage Technicianis responsible for performing advanced low voltage installations, terminations,and troubleshooting for fiber optic systems, access control, surveillance, andstructured cabling. This traveling role covers job sites across Texas, the GulfCoast, and the southeastern U.S., requiring independence, leadership, and astrong technical background. This position also supports cross-functionalefforts and may lead or mentor junior technicians.

Essential Duties andResponsibilities
  • Fiber Optics: Terminate, splice (fusion), and test fiber optic cable using OTDR andpower meter testing equipment.
  • Access Control: Install and configure systems including door hardware, readers, panels,and power supplies.
  • Surveillance Systems: Install, aim, and program IP CCTV systems; experience with Genetec andAvigilon preferred.
  • Structured Cabling: Troubleshoot and repair low voltage cabling systems, includingCat5e/6/6A and fiber.
  • Documentation: Read and interpret construction drawings, risers, schematics, andtechnical manuals.
  • Travel: Perform work on remote job sites requiring overnight stays.
  • Communication: Interface with customers, project managers, and site personnel to ensurejob clarity and satisfaction.
  • Mentorship: Support training and development of apprentices and junior technicians.
  • Safety & Quality: Maintain a strong focus on job safety, accuracy, and craftsmanship.
